Capsomnia turns Caps Lock into keep-awake switch

Capsomnia transforms the Mac Caps Lock key into a physical toggle switch to keep MacBooks running when the lid is closed. Developed by Taketo Fujimaki, the free and open-source utility uses the Caps Lock LED as a status indicator to ensure uninterrupted background execution for AI coding agents and long-running tasks.

// ANALYSIS

Transforming a rarely used physical key like Caps Lock into a dedicated hardware toggle for system sleep behavior is a stroke of developer UX genius, especially for AI-assisted workflows.

• Hardware-Level Visual Feedback: Utilizing the physical Caps Lock LED light gives immediate, unmistakable state feedback without relying on desktop UI or menu bar icons.

• Solves AI Agent Interruption: Directly addresses the modern friction point of background AI agents or long CLI jobs dying when closing a laptop lid.

• Zero-Trust Privacy Model: Completely open-source, fully signed and notarized, with no telemetry, data collection, or account creation required.

• Flexible Remapping: Allows remapping if Caps Lock is already assigned to hyperkeys or input methods.
